Answer:
a = 15, b = 7, c = 4
Step-by-step explanation:
Here's some facts that help with such tasks:
[tex](x^y)^z = x^{y\cdot z}\\\\\sqrt[y]{x} = x^{\frac{1}{y}}\\\\\sqrt[y]{x^z} = (x^z)^{\frac{1}{y}} = x^{\frac{z}{y}}\\\\\textrm{Using the last one we know:}\\\sqrt[4]{15^7} = 15^\frac{7}{4}\\\\\textrm{And bonus, not needed in this task:}\\x^y \cdot x^z = x^{y+z}[/tex]
